When considering roofing alternatives, home owners usually consider the benefits of various products. Asphalt roof shingles remain a preferred selection because of their affordability and convenience of setup. They provide a good equilibrium of durability and appearances, making them suitable for several architectural designs. Metal roof covering, understood for its long life and resistance to extreme weather condition, is an additional popular choice. It shows warm efficiently, which might add to power financial savings in warmer climates. Clay and concrete floor tiles supply a distinct look and extraordinary sturdiness, usually lasting over fifty years. These materials are fireproof and do well in hot climates. Slate roof covering, while more costly, is celebrated for its appeal and durability, appealing to those seeking a high-end visual. Each material provides distinct advantages, allowing property owners to select the most effective alternative based upon budget plan, climate, and personal preferences. The selection of roof covering products not only impacts aesthetic appeals and cost however likewise plays a considerable role in energy effectiveness. A well-designed roof can reflect sunlight, decreasing warm absorption and reducing cooling expenses during warmer months. For example, lighter-colored roofings or those with reflective coatings can enhance energy efficiency by minimizing the heat island result in city locations.Furthermore, the insulation buildings of roof covering materials add to power cost savings by maintaining stable interior temperatures. Products such as metal, clay tiles, or asphalt tiles with high thermal resistance can substantially enhance a home's energy efficiency.

Typical Roof Covering Problems and Solutions
Roof covering systems are vulnerable to a selection of problems that can endanger their stability and long life. Usual problems consist of leaks, which frequently arise from damaged tiles or endangered flashing. These leakages can result in water damage within the home, necessitating punctual repair services. One more frequent problem is the accumulation of debris, such as fallen leaves and branches, which can trap wetness and advertise mold and mildew growth. The length of time Does a Typical Roof Installment Take?
A normal roofing installation takes in between one to 3 days, depending on numerous variables such as the roofing type, weather conditions, and the complexity of the project. Larger or even more complex roofings may call for extra time.
